Estero Builder's Checklist
Your development, building, or signage is NOT within the Estero Planning
Community.
If your development, building or signage is adjacent to or nearby the boundary
of the Estero Planning Community, the ECPP and EDRC welcome courtesy
presentations.
While not required, courtesy presentations are a terrific way to meet with
the public and get feedback on your project. You can also use the
Land
Development Code requirements for the Estero Planning Community to blend your
project in with neighboring projects.
